Output 53fdf3342049356c5b75a3af2835da93d2c9e5eac5998e9288b1b3435dc73255:0

value
826048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81493e084853e3991d220f0c9896afbae1877379 OP_EQUAL
address
3DUcqFkHJtncvHiuEbBbtTFSB6HZHzQTT7
transaction
53fdf3342049356c5b75a3af2835da93d2c9e5eac5998e9288b1b3435dc73255
spent
true